Ti-doped PdAu catalysts for one-pot hydrogenation and ring opening of furfural

Articolo
Data di Pubblicazione:
2018
Abstract:
Pd-Au bimetallic catalysts with different Pd/Au atomic ratios, supported on ordered structured silica (Hexagonal mesoporous silica--HMS, or Santa Barbara Amorphous-15--SBA-15) were evaluated for one-pot hydrogenation of furfural to 1,2-pentanediol. The surface and structural properties of the catalysts were deeply investigated by X-ray photoelectron spectroscopy (XPS), X-ray diffraction (XRD), N2 adsorption isotherms (BET), Infrared spectroscopy (IR), and acid capacity measurements. XPS studies revealed that Ti doped supports had higher dispersion of the active phase, particularly in the case of Pd-Au materials in which Ti played an important role in stabilizing the metallic species. Among the various process conditions studied, such as temperature (160 C), catalyst amount (10% w/w), and reaction time (5 h), H2 pressure (500 psi) was found to improve the 1,2-pentanediol selectivity. The SBA silica bimetallic Ti-doped system showed the best performance in terms of stability and reusability, after multiple cycles. Under specific reaction conditions, the synergism between Pd-Au alloy and Ti doping of the support allowed the ring opening pathway towards the formation of 1,2-pentanediol in furfural hydrogenation.
